Abstract:
Objective To study the effects of operation time of durotomy on acute spinal cord contusion. Methods Spinal cord contusion models were established in SD rats at T 9 by NYU-Ⅱ impactor.Durotomy was performed immediately(group C),1 h(group D),6 h(group E)and 12 h(group F)after spinal cord contusion, respectively.Rats in group B did not receive durotomy.Open-field locomotor function was evaluated using the Basso-Beattie-Bresnahan(BBB)locomotor rating scale at days 1,3,7,14,21 and 28 after injury in order to compare damage degree of the spinal cord.The percentage of cavity volume(CV%)and lesion length were calculated by"Imagej"software using serial sections stained by hematoxylin/eosin(HE).Results The BBB score in groups C and D was significantly better than that in group B(P < 0.01);CV% and lesion length were significantly lower than those in group B(P<0.01).The BBB score was higher in group E than in group B(P<0.05),but lower than in groups C and D.Similarly,CV% was lower than that in group B(P<0.05),but higher than that in groups C and D(P<0.05).No difference was found between groups F and B in the BBB score,CV%or lesion length(P>0.05).Conclusion Decompressive durotomy improved motor function recovery and reduced the damage of the spinal cord in the setting of a thoracic spinal cord contusion injury in SD rats within 6 h after injury.Durotomy 12 h after injury does not affect function outcomes or spinal cord injury after injury.
